Manawatu Citizens’ Panel Rates District Vision

Recent Manawatu District Council Citizens' Panel results about the future of the Manawatu District  have been posted on the Council Website.

It was an interesting survey which gave the panel of more than 580 residents to comment on the Council outcomes and to prioritise these outcomes.

Citizens Panels in New Zealand – Complimentary Research Report

As part of the launch of PublicVoice we have compiled a special research into Citizens Panels in New Zealand.

This report supports the use of Citizens’ Panels as a consultation tool for local government. It summarises the legislative context for consultation, and the way in which councils currently meet their obligations to consult the community. It describes the concept of a Citizens’ Panel, and the advantages of using a Panel. The report concludes with a case study of the Citizens’ Panel developed by Palmerston North City Council.
